Transaction 795b94d81a016698188baf8edd48ee0858dd7bd7337729ab38a701dcca36e6bb
1 Input
1 Output
-
795b94d81a016698188baf8edd48ee0858dd7bd7337729ab38a701dcca36e6bb:0
- value
- 743915
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 658c8bea725188085c4fec05629b7d1a5cc7f964 OP_EQUAL
- address
- 3AwxYGFqhHpayvBdN42CNtNJV3cj28LV7M